Parking changes at Gillette Stadium
FOXBORO -- If you're planning on going to Gillette Stadium this weekend and haven't yet been to a game this season, there have been some changes to changes to Gillette Stadium's parking configuration since last season that you should keep in mind before you arrive.
Due to construction, the majority of spaces available have moved across Route 1, away from the stadium.
If you’re coming from the North:
Save yourself time by staying to the right and parking in P10. You’ll have more time to tailgate with easier access to and exiting the stadium. You will have to cross Route 1 at the marked pedestrian crossings, but P10 is still your best bet.
If you’re coming from the South:
Because of the newly-built median on Route 1, you’ll have to decide on which side of Route 1 you will park prior to the Pine Street intersection (near the Seasonal Specialty Stores and The Lafayette House).
If you want to park on the left side of Route 1 (P10 or P11), stay to the left of the median. If you want to park on the stadium side of Route 1, stay to the right (P8 or P7).
